Output d62823fce91d06782eecb29a42f9824fa1e2f09f6c9cc13e88719a438edb4725:1

value
77855760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ecc1d4deeacbe5df39e5f281816a6e4988140fa OP_EQUALVERIFY OP_CHECKSIG
address
12MEyoqxvDWs9D87RfH1n2qUW4URbXJZfo
transaction
d62823fce91d06782eecb29a42f9824fa1e2f09f6c9cc13e88719a438edb4725
spent
true